Вы можете отправлять данные в Zapier через вебхуки Blue.
Zapier — это платформа интеграции, которая помогает соединять различные веб-приложения и автоматизировать рабочие процессы.
Сценарии использования
Вот некоторые из самых популярных способов интеграции Blue с другими приложениями через Zapier:
Синхронизация записей Blue с Google Sheets
По мере создания или обновления записей Blue автоматически добавляйте их в качестве новых строк в таблицу Google для централизованной отчетности.
Отправка подтверждения заказа из записей Blue
Когда вы выбираете определенное настраиваемое поле в Blue, автоматически отправляйте электронное письмо для подтверждения заказа вашему клиенту.
Добавление комментариев Blue в Slack
Получайте уведомления Blue в реальном времени, публикуемые в нужных каналах Slack, чтобы ваша команда была в курсе важных обновлений записей.
Ключевые преимущества
Автоматизация между инструментами: Zaps, созданные в Zapier, могут автоматически отправлять и получать данные между Blue и тысячами других приложений. Это устраняет ручную работу по перемещению данных между системами.
Интеграции в реальном времени: Используя триггеры вебхуков Blue, Zaps мгновенно реагируют на события в Blue, такие как новая запись, добавленный комментарий, изменение статуса и т. д. Это позволяет осуществлять синхронизацию в реальном времени и автоматизацию процессов.
Простота создания и поддержки: Zaps предоставляют удобный способ интеграции инструментов без кода. Не требуется разработка. И они продолжают работать без постоянного обслуживания.
Настройка вебхука в Blue
- Войдите в свою учетную запись Blue в настройках профиля
- Перейдите в настройки профиля и нажмите "Вебхуки"
- Нажмите "Добавить вебхук"
- Дайте вебхуку имя и введите URL вебхука Zapier
- Выберите, какие события должны запускать вебхук
- Нажмите "Создать вебхук"
Blue в Zapier
- Войдите в свою учетную запись Zapier
- Нажмите "Создать Zap"
- На первом шаге найдите и выберите приложение-триггер "Webhooks by Zapier"
- Настройте его для приема полезных нагрузок из вашего URL вебхука Blue
- На втором шаге найдите и выберите целевое приложение для отправки данных
- Сопоставьте поля полезной нагрузки JSON с входными полями целевого приложения
- Включите Zap
Теперь, когда указанные события происходят в Blue, полезная нагрузка вебхука будет отправлена в Zapier, который автоматически передает данные в ваше интегрированное приложение согласно настройкам Zap.
Zapier в Blue
Чтобы отправить данные из других приложений в Blue, выполните следующие шаги:
1. Получите учетные данные API Blue
- Перейдите в Настройки Blue > Токены API
- Создайте новый токен или используйте существующие учетные данные:
- Идентификатор токена
- Секрет токена
- Идентификатор компании
- Идентификатор проекта
2. Создайте Zap в Zapier
- Настройте ваше приложение-триггер (например, Google Sheets, Slack и т. д.)
- Добавьте "Webhooks by Zapier" в качестве приложения действия
- Выберите тип события "Пользовательский запрос"
3. Настройте вебхук
- Метод: POST
- URL:
https://api.blue.cc/graphql
(или бета-эндпоинт, если необходимо) - Передача данных: ЛОЖЬ
- Развернуть: НЕТ
4. Установите заголовки:
{
"Content-Type": "application/json",
"X-Bloo-Token-ID": "Your_Token_ID",
"X-Bloo-Token-Secret": "Your_Token_Secret",
"X-Bloo-Company-ID": "Your_Company_ID",
"X-Bloo-Project-ID": "Your_Project_ID"
}
5. Настройте запрос (пример мутации):
{
"query": "mutation CreateTodo($input: CreateTodoInput!) {\n createTodo(input: $input) {\n id\n title\n customFields {\n value\n }\n }\n}",
"variables": {
"input": {
"todoListId": "your-todo-list-id",
"title": "New task from Zapier",
"customFields": [
{
"customFieldId": "priority-field-id",
"value": "High"
},
{
"customFieldId": "due-date-field-id",
"value": "2024-03-01"
}
]
}
}
}
6. Тестирование и активация
- Сначала протестируйте мутации с помощью API Playground Blue
- Сопоставьте динамические значения из триггерных приложений, используя поля данных Zapier
- Включите Zap после успешного тестирования